If you are locked out of the house, replacing the lock may not be the answer. A good locksmith can open virtually any door with no need for a replacement of the lock. There will always be additional cost involved if locks must be replaced unnecessarily.
Be skeptical of any locksmith that quotes one price when he arrives. This can be a way to get money from a desperate person.

If you need to paint your house, cover all locks before painting doors. You will have to get a locksmith out if the hole is sealed because you won’t get your key to fit in. It might take some extra time, but you will lose even more time and money if you end up having to call a locksmith to come fix your locks.

You want to be sure that you get a receipt once you pay a locksmith. Most locksmiths are trustable, but some are scammers. So make sure that you have a receipt that says you have paid in full. Keep the receipt in case there is any question with regard to payment later.
Check out a locksmith’s credentials before you let him entry to your home. You can accomplish this by comparing his business address with their given phone number. With the wide reach of the Internet, checking someone out is quite easy, so take advantage of this!
Be sure to ask about proper identification for any locksmith you plan to hire. Professionals should be in uniform and proper identification.
Contact the local Better Business Bureau to find out if the locksmith is legitimate. This can help you identify any person trying to scam you. Also, ALOA.org is another great organization that you can check to verify any locksmith you wish to use.

Locksmith service calls are more costly after regular business hours. Some people take advantage of this to charge unreasonable rates. You can avoid this by obtaining quotes from multiple locksmiths.
Inquire about the experience that the locksmith has. Make sure they’ve been doing operations from the same location. A locksmith with more than a few years of experience would be a great choice.
Do not forget that you are providing access to your home. If you feel they are not entirely honest and trustworthy, you should not hire them for the work. You might feel better arranging a meeting at their business before allowing them know where you live.
If you want to file a complaint about the services you received, be sure to take it up with the company quickly. If you do not, they may not fix the issue for free. If they won’t help you out, call your local news station and see if they can help expose the problem.
Google your prospective locksmith. You can often find websites and forums geared toward reviews in your particular area. When locating these review sites, make sure no locksmith is associated with them. Check the BBB website as well.
